ABU DAWUD, Sulaiman bin Al-Ash^ath

Posted on August 17, 2010 By Riad Nachef

ABU DAWUD, Sulaiman bin Al-Ash^ath 220-275 H Abu Dawud, Sulaiman bin Al-Ash^ath bin Ishaq Al-Azdi As-Sijistani, who was one of the eminent Imam of Hadith, was born in 202H. He studied Hadith under Imam Ahmad bin Hanbal along with Al-Bukhari and taught many of the later scholars of Hadith, like At-Tirmidhi and An-Nasa‘i. Though Abu…
